Published: 2002-09-23, review by: cnet.com
- Abstract: <b>Spec:</b> Microsoft Pocket PC 2002, Stylus, Touch-screen, 5-way joystick, IrDA, Intel 400 MHz, 64 MB<br> <b>Good:</b> Terrific screen; XScale processor; built-in Secure Digital card slot; fits existing iPaq sleeves; consumer IR; nice software bundle.<br> <b>Bad:</b> Expensive; no built-in CompactFlash card slot.<br> <b>Bottomline:</b> The H3950 has lots of things to recommend it--especially its screen--but its overpriced.<br>
